We just finished episode 14 of Arrow S2 and this season has definitely improved on the first but I do have two issues with it. The first is just a nitpick, but I am really sick to death of hearing them pronounce Ra's' name as Raz!! It is very annoying and was the only negative I had about Nolan's trilogy. The name is freaking Ra's!! Denny O'Neil states it is Ra's. They even mentioned how it should pronounced in Batman Beyond. How the hell do these guys not know how this guy's name is supposed to be pronounced?
My second issue is with Black Canary. I'm not sure if it is just the way she is written, or the actress, but I do not care for her one bit. Her acting comes off stiff and she just does not scream Black Canary to me at all. I also hate her mask.
Aside from that, it has been a great season so far but I am surprised they chose to bring in Nyssa instead of Talia. Well, I hope we get to see Ra's and he lays down the law of how to properly pronounce his name. I do think Michael Jai White makes a great Bronze Tiger though and their version of Clock King was kind of cool.
